Canoo Expands UK Presence with New Hub for Electric Vans

24 September, 2024: Canoo Inc., a leading electric vehicle manufacturer, has officially launched its commercial operations in the UK, marking a significant step in its global expansion efforts. The establishment of Canoo Technologies UK Limited will enable the company to meet the increasing demand in the UK’s light commercial vehicle (LCV) market.

Located at Bicester Motion, the new hub will allow customers to experience Canoo’s right-hand drive electric vans firsthand. This strategic move comes as the UK leads the charge in EV adoption, supported by ambitious zero-emission vehicle mandates.

Canoo’s entry into the UK reflects its commitment to sustainability and innovation in mobility solutions. By positioning itself at Bicester Motion, a site renowned for automotive advancements, Canoo aligns itself with the UK’s targets for zero-emission vehicles. The facility will serve not only as a space for test drives but also as a base for further expansion into European markets.

The UK’s favourable regulatory environment, including incentives such as the Plug-in Van Grant (PIVG), makes it an attractive market for Canoo’s commercial electric vans. The company plans to adopt a customer-centric approach, collaborating with fleet operators and government entities to tailor its offerings to diverse business needs.

Leading this expansion is Tony Aquila, Canoo’s Executive Chairman and CEO, who has a proven track record in the UK for creating jobs and generating significant revenue through previous ventures. With this new initiative, Canoo aims to capitalise on the growing demand for sustainable transportation solutions.

The UK operation is expected to launch in October 2024, further enhancing Canoo’s global presence and advancing its mission to deliver cutting-edge electric mobility solutions.
